When it comes to crossbreeds, the Shepsky French Bulldog mix is one of the more unique combinations out there. This hybrid dog is a mix between a German Shepherd and a Siberian Husky on one side, and a French Bulldog on the other. The result is a dog that combines the loyalty and intelligence of the German Shepherd and Husky with the playful and affectionate nature of the French Bulldog.
The Shepsky French Bulldog mix can take on characteristics of both parent breeds. They are typically medium to large in size, with a sturdy build and a thick coat. Their coat can be a mix of colors, including black, white, brown, and brindle. They often have the signature bat-like ears of the French Bulldog and the striking colored eyes of the Husky.

When it comes to temperament, the Shepsky French Bulldog mix can vary depending on which traits they inherit from their parent breeds. However, they are typically known to be intelligent, loyal, and playful dogs. They are great with families and can be good with children and other pets if socialized properly.
They are also known to be protective of their families and can make good guard dogs. However, they can also be prone to separation anxiety if left alone for long periods of time, so it is important to provide them with plenty of mental stimulation and exercise.
Due to their intelligent nature, the Shepsky French Bulldog mix is typically easy to train. They respond well to positive reinforcement techniques and enjoy learning new tricks and commands. However, they can also be stubborn at times, so consistency is key when it comes to training.
When it comes to exercise, the Shepsky French Bulldog mix is an active dog that requires plenty of physical activity to stay healthy and happy. They enjoy long walks, hikes, and playtime in the yard. They also excel at agility and obedience training, so providing them with mental stimulation is important.
The Shepsky French Bulldog mix has a thick coat that requires regular grooming to keep it looking its best. They typically shed year-round, so regular brushing is recommended to prevent matting and tangles. They may also require occasional baths to keep their coat clean and healthy.
Additionally, it is important to keep their ears clean and dry to prevent infections, as they can be prone to ear problems due to their floppy ears. Regular teeth brushing is also recommended to prevent dental issues.
As with any crossbreed, the Shepsky French Bulldog mix can inherit health issues from either parent breed. Common health issues to watch out for include hip dysplasia, eye problems, and respiratory issues. It is important to work with a reputable breeder who can provide health clearances for both parent breeds.
